Subject: [PATCH v5 1/2] dt-bindings: display: bridge: lvds-codec: Document pixel data sampling edge select
Date: Sun, 17 Oct 2021 02:12:03 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20211017001204.299940-1-marex@denx.de> (raw)

The OnSemi FIN3385 Parallel-to-LVDS encoder has a dedicated input line to
select input pixel data sampling edge. Add DT property "pclk-sample", not
the same as the one used by display timings but rather the same as used by
media, to define the pixel data sampling edge.

 .../bindings/display/bridge/lvds-codec.yaml    | 18 ++++++++++++++++++
 1 file changed, 18 insertions(+)

diff --git a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/display/bridge/lvds-codec.yaml b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/display/bridge/lvds-codec.yaml
index 1faae3e323a4..708de84ac138 100644
--- a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/display/bridge/lvds-codec.yaml
+++ b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/display/bridge/lvds-codec.yaml
@@ -79,6 +79,14 @@ properties:
       - port@0
       - port@1
 
+  pclk-sample:
+    description:
+      Data sampling on rising or falling edge.
+    enum:
+      - 0  # Falling edge
+      - 1  # Rising edge
+    default: 0
+
   powerdown-gpios:
     description:
       The GPIO used to control the power down line of this device.
@@ -102,6 +110,16 @@ then:
               properties:
                 data-mapping: false
 
+if:
+  not:
+    properties:
+      compatible:
+        contains:
+          const: lvds-encoder
+then:
+  properties:
+    pclk-sample: false
+
 required:
   - compatible
   - ports
